Angelica Kaufman-Style Table, Early 19th Century

This is a charming early 19th century small tilt-top table. The top is painted in the style of Angelica Kauffman; the four-column pedestal bases is detailed in florals over a deep Italian green. The painted surface is in overall good to very good condition considering its age and use. At one point this was a tilt top table which is now fixed.
